Murfreesboro, TN, July 28, 2017 -- SceneDoc, public safety’s new standard for data collection, will be attending the Tennessee Association of Chiefs of Police (TACP) Annual Conference, August 2-5 in Murfreesboro, Tennessee. The TACP Annual Conference offers a venue for SceneDoc to announce their recent expansion within the Brentwood Police Department. Having doubled their subscription, Brentwood’s Chief of Police and TACP President Jeff Hughes had this to say: “We continue to expand our use of SceneDoc to meet our initiatives to save money and reduce administrative overhead. Two clear benefits delivered by SceneDoc.”
Evolutionary for police, SceneDoc turns citation data, paperwork and notes into real-time searchable and actionable intelligence. It’s saving front-line officers an hour per shift, increasing the quality of information being gathered and provides all parties involved, the ability to find and share this information down the line, on-demand and in near real-time.
Six months ago, SceneDoc launched a ‘mobile first’ offering for eCitations as a follow up to their flagship product, Collect. This latest module of the platform has been quickly gaining traction around the globe.
The company recently was awarded the coveted “Motorola Solutions Award for Public Safety Technology,” named as a leading innovator of public safety solutions that helps build safer cities and thriving communities.
